Crossbrowser JavaScript Ticker
 
This ticker is based on the AVS Forum Ticker. Is is JavaScript based, hence should work on any modern browser (unlike marquee based tickers). Should work on any 2.x version.

You can see it in action at IRCZONE.CL (Click on the Telepost link under the Navegaci?n menu).

Hey! It's in Spanish! Not the version released in here. I took the time to have all strings on a config file so you can change/translate them at will.

Instalation should be drop and load, but there are some variables to configure if you'd like to change the look and feel. Just unzip the attached file on top of your vB root (no files will be changed, just a new directory "ticker" added).
